Why I Would Start A Technology Company Today

A wave of pessimism has crashed over the technology industry recently. Layoffs, budget cuts, and declining public market technology stocks have led some to conclude that the current environment is inhospitable to new ventures. But this is the wrong outlook. 

As an entrepreneur and venture capitalist, my main gripe with this conclusion is that it may persuade budding entrepreneurs to forgo starting their new company or developing their new product. If this viewpoint is widely internalized and adopted, American innovation will be stifled. We need obsessive dreamers to change the world and move it forward.
